Transaction 052563dea05b21812c4de9fe3322c0416264451f280281a98cbc370c2fde8b1f
1 Input
1 Output
-
052563dea05b21812c4de9fe3322c0416264451f280281a98cbc370c2fde8b1f:0
- value
- 883405
- script pubkey
- OP_0 OP_PUSHBYTES_20 22451d86e9ade419c071af3e968c3eeaf822f684
- address
- bc1qyfz3mphf4hjpnsr34ulfdrp7atuz9a5y02ru2c